Associate two already existing objects using Has And Belongs To Many

I'm making an App in Rails to show anime, these animes has and belongs to many languages, so I made a HABTM association:

class Anime < ActiveRecord::Base
  has_and_belongs_to_many :languages
end

class Language < ActiveRecord::Base
  has_and_belongs_to_many :animes
end

Now I don't know how can I make associations between them, I've created many Languages' records to use them, for example, Language with ID 1 is English, Language with ID 2 is Spanish, etc... And I want to just make the associations between an anime and a language, ie, if I want to say that the Anime with ID 1 it's available in Spanish only, then in the table animes_languages I want to create the record with values anime_id: 1 and language_id: 2 and nothing more, but I belive that if I execute the command Anime.find(1).languages.create it will not use an already existing language, it will create a new language, but the only thing I want is to make associations between already existing animes with already existing languages, so, How can I do this? Should I make a model for the table animes_language?

It's confusing for me cause when I created that table as specified here enter link description here, I created the table without ID, it only have the fields anime_id and language_id.
